Data Scientist: The Sherlock Holmes of Data
Think of a data scientist as a modern-day sleuth. If you love solving puzzles and have an analytical mind, this might be your calling. Data scientists gather, process, and analyze vast amounts of data to uncover patterns and insights that drive decision-making. It’s like being Sherlock Holmes, but instead of solving crimes, you’re solving business problems.
Skills Needed
- Mathematics & Statistics: The backbone of any data-driven investigation.
- Programming: Languages like Python or R are your tools of the trade.
- Data Visualization: Communicating your findings is key, so tools like Tableau help make data digestible.
Machine Learning Engineer: The Architect of Intelligence
While data scientists focus on the ‘why’, machine learning engineers focus on the ‘how’. They are the builders, creating algorithms and deploying models that can predict outcomes or automate tasks. It’s akin to being an architect who designs digital brains.
Skills Needed
- Programming: Strong proficiency in Python, Java, or C++.
- Software Engineering: Understanding software development processes.
- Model Deployment: Skills in deploying models into production environments.

AI Research Scientist: The Trailblazer of New Frontiers
AI research scientists are the pioneers, pushing the boundaries of what’s possible. If you’re driven by curiosity and innovation, this is where you belong. These professionals spend their time in labs, dreaming up and testing new algorithms that could revolutionize the field.
Skills Needed
- PhD Level Expertise: Often required in fields like computer science or mathematics.
- Research Experience: Published papers and ongoing research projects.
- Deep Learning: Specialization in neural networks and other advanced concepts.
Data Analyst: The Storyteller of Insights
If you’re passionate about telling stories with data, the role of a data analyst might be your perfect fit. Data analysts interpret data and translate it into actionable insights, guiding business decisions and strategies. It’s all about making the numbers speak.
Skills Needed
- Excel & SQL: Bread and butter tools for managing and querying data.
- Critical Thinking: Ability to glean insights from complex data sets.
- Communication: Clearly articulating findings to stakeholders.
Robotics Engineer: Bringing AI to Life
Are you fascinated by the idea of robots walking among us? Robotics engineers design and build mechanical devices that incorporate machine learning algorithms, allowing these machines to perform tasks autonomously.
Skills Needed
- Mechanical Engineering: Understanding the principles of building machinery.
- Control Systems: Expertise in systems that control robot behavior.
- Programming: Knowledge of C++ and Python for algorithm implementation.
Business Intelligence Developer: The Strategist of Data
Business intelligence developers use data analytics to inform strategic decisions. They focus on improving the efficiency of operations and identifying new business opportunities. It’s like having a crystal ball that shows the future of business trends.
Skills Needed
- BI Tools: Proficiency in platforms like Power BI or Qlik.
- Data Warehousing: Understanding data storage solutions.
- Analytical Skills: Interpreting data trends to suggest strategic moves.
Ethical AI Specialist: The Guardian of Morality
As AI becomes more prevalent, the ethical implications of these technologies can’t be ignored. Ethical AI specialists are tasked with ensuring that AI systems operate within moral and legal frameworks. They are the moral compass of the AI world.
Skills Needed
- Ethical Theory: Understanding of ethics in technology.
- AI Policy: Knowledge of regulations governing AI.
- Communication: Articulating ethical concerns to diverse audiences.
Exploring Niche Roles and Emerging Opportunities
In addition to traditional roles, machine learning opens doors to niche areas like quantum machine learning, healthcare AI, and environmental modeling. Each niche presents unique challenges and exciting possibilities.
- Quantum Machine Learning: Blending quantum computing with machine learning to solve complex problems faster.
- Healthcare AI: Developing systems for diagnostics, treatment planning, and personalized medicine.
- Environmental Modeling: Using AI to predict climate changes and manage resources sustainably.

Frequently Asked Questions
What is the demand for machine learning professionals?
The demand for machine learning professionals has skyrocketed, with industries across the board seeking AI talent to drive innovation and efficiency.
How do I start a career in machine learning?
Start by building a solid foundation in mathematics and programming. Online courses, certifications, and hands-on projects can further enhance your skills.
What is the average salary for a machine learning engineer?
Salaries vary by location and experience, but in the U.S., a machine learning engineer can expect an average salary of $112,000 per year[^source].
Are there opportunities for remote work in machine learning?
Yes, many companies offer remote positions, especially in roles like data science and machine learning engineering, which require computer-based work.
How important is a degree for a career in machine learning?
While a degree can be beneficial, practical experience and a robust portfolio are equally important. Many successful professionals in this field are self-taught.
What are the future trends in machine learning careers?
Trends include the rise of explainable AI, advancements in natural language processing, and the integration of AI in edge devices and IoT.
